ORGANIZATION OF THE SCHOOL

 

Age groups

Ages

Classroom Ratios

Infant

6 weeks to 18 months

Maximum of 9 children with ~ 1:3 ratio

Toddler

12 months to 30 months

Maximum of 11 children with ~ 1:4 ratio

Youngest Preschool

2 years to 3 years

Maximum of 12 children with ~ 1:5 ratio

Oldest Preschool

3 years to 4 years

Maximum of 12 children with ~ 1:6 ratio

Pre-Kindergarten

4 years to 5 years

Maximum of 14 children with ~ 1:7 ratio

Kindergarten

5 years

Maximum of 14 children with ~ 1:7 ratio


Faculty

Qualifications

Mentor Teachers

Master’s degree in Education, completed Teacher Education Program

Mentern Teachers

Master’s degree in Education (or in process), completed Teacher Education Program

Intern Teachers

Bachelor’s degree, enrolled in Teacher Education Program

Administrative faculty include an Executive Director, two Directors, a Business Manager, and a Building and Office Manager.

Additional faculty include a Theater Arts Teacher, two Studio Teachers, a Technology Manager, and several Support Teachers.

All faculty have extensive background checks, CPR and First Aid certifications, and Universal Precautions training.

All teachers participate in ongoing professional development. Opportunities include: weekly planning meetings, monthly faculty meetings, workshops, inservices, professional development groups, and work with consultants.


7:30-8:00

Early drop off for all students in the theater: beginning the day, greeting friends and families, reading stories, playing games, dressing up…

8:00-9:00

Before school enrichment in classrooms: preparing for the day, watering plants, feeding classroom pets, collecting and sorting materials from the studio, welcoming more friends…

9:00-1:00

Class time: exchanging ideas with families, friends, and faculty, attending a group meeting, making decisions about the day, pursuing interests, working on projects, eating together, exploring outside, negotiating and resolving conflicts, collaborating, visiting the studio and the theater, sharing stories, singing songs, revisiting documentation, going on adventures in the school and in the community…

1:00-5:00

Afternoon enrichment in classrooms: napping, resting, continuing projects,  reflecting on the day…

5:00-5:30

Late pick up for all students in the theater: ending the day, dancing to music, performing, acting, climbing, running, playing with friends, saying goodbye…
